Radio (CAN) Soundsystem basic: speaker in front doors left and right; speaker in the front panel on the left and right
Radio (CAN) Soundsystem basic plus: speaker in front doors left and right;speaker in the front panel on the left and right; 2 speakers in the rear doors, left and right
Radio (CAN) Soundsystem Standard: speaker in front doors left and right; speaker in the front panel on the left, in the center and on the right; 2 speakers in the rear doors, left and right; Subwoofer in the rear shelf "R157" (in the spare wheel niche); Used digital acoustic package "J525"
MMI Soundsystem basic: loudspeaker in front doors left and right; speaker in the front panel on the left and right; 2 speakers in the rear doors, left and right
MMI Soundsystem Standard: Speaker in front doors left and right; speaker in the front panel on the left, in the center and on the right; 2 speakers in the rear doors, left and right; Subwoofer in the rear shelf "R157" (in the spare wheel niche)
Radio (CAN)/MMI Soundsystem Premium (Bang & Olufsen): speaker in the front doors on the left and right; speaker in the triangular element of the mirror on the left and right; speaker in the front panel on the left, in the center and on the right; 2 speakers in the rear doors, left and right; 2 speakers in D-pillars left and right; Subwoofer in the rear shelf "R157" (in the spare wheel niche); Used digital acoustic package "J525"
Notes on the MOST bus
In addition to the CAN-BUS, the optical data bus "MOST-BUS" is used. Connection to other bus systems is made via the diagnostic interface of the data bus "J533". A light guide is used as a "connecting cable". For protection, the light guides are laid in corrugated tubes. If possible, replace the entire optical cable. Ensure that the end surfaces of the plug connections are not contaminated. The plug connectors are disconnected: put on the protective cap for the cable plugs "VAS 6223/9".
When laying the light guides, observe the minimum bending radius of 25 mm. Do not squeeze or bend the light guides.
